Hey Richg101,

No idea if this track is the same as the one from the polll or how much it has been adjusted since then. You keep flooding the forum with more tracks at the same time, we just can not keep up with you Ease up on use will ya hahaha

I am going to review this track as the track I heard in the poll and basically it is a very simple review:

- Melody/atmosphere : brilliant
- Percussionwise : WORK ON IT MATE

You miss the chance of having an excellent track because the percussion is not driving enough. The kick is poor and I would suggest that you have a hihat going all the time during build up. Add a nice deep clap after each kick. Add a good hihatriff and pan it. Stuff like that. Just listen a lot to how M.I.K.E does his percussions mate.

Also the break is a tad bit long. If you want to be played on a dancefloor you need to make the track a bit more crowd friendly
